Setting Your 2000 Wedding Budget Where Every Dollar Goes

Breaking Down The Core Budget Categories For 30 Guests

A two thousand dollar budget requires strict discipline across five main pillars. You must prioritize the marriage license and venue first to ensure legal compliance. Food and drink consume the largest share of the remaining funds. For thirty guests, you cannot afford traditional full service catering. Focus on drop off service or bulk purchases. This allocation leaves minimal room for high cost professional photography or floral arrangements.

  • Public Venue Permits: City parks and national forests offer fixed rate permits that often cost less than two hundred dollars. These spaces provide natural backdrops which eliminate the need for expensive decorations. Verify all local insurance requirements and guest count limits before booking your date.
  • Bulk Food Service: Local restaurants offer catering trays that feed groups of thirty for under six hundred dollars. Choosing self service buffet styles removes the need for hired servers. This strategy ensures guests eat well without the overhead costs of traditional wedding venues.
  • Digital Media Strategy: Hire a student photographer or book a professional for a two hour window only. This covers the ceremony and core portraits without paying for an eight hour day. You receive high quality images of the most important moments while staying within a strict three hundred dollar limit.
  • Simplified Attire: Purchase off the rack clothing or high quality second hand items to keep costs low. Consignment shops and online marketplaces offer designer gowns and suits for a fraction of retail prices. This leaves more money for the guest experience while maintaining a polished and professional aesthetic.
  • Beverage Management: Buying wine and beer in bulk from wholesale clubs keeps the drink budget under three hundred dollars. Stick to a limited menu of two options to simplify logistics. Avoid a full open bar as liquor licenses and mixers quickly drain your available cash.

Eliminate non essential items like printed programs and elaborate favors immediately. These small costs add up and provide little value to the guest experience. Focus your spending on what guests remember most which is quality food and a comfortable environment. Use digital invitations to remove printing and postage fees from your ledger. This aggressive prioritization keeps your wedding under 2000 while maintaining a professional standard.

Food And Drinks Feeding 30 Guests Without Blowing Your Wedding Under 1000 Budget

Affordable Catering Styles That Feel Elevated And Personal

Standard wedding catering costs start at sixty dollars per person. This price point breaks a two thousand dollar budget instantly. You must pivot to drop off catering from local restaurants. Order large pans of high quality pasta or street tacos. This strategy keeps costs under fifteen dollars per guest. You pay for the food rather than the onsite staff and service fees.

Presentation changes the value of cheap food. Remove plastic containers immediately upon delivery. Place all hot food into stainless steel chafing dishes or ceramic platters. Use real serving utensils instead of plastic ones. This mimicry of traditional buffet service creates a professional look. Guests focus on flavor and heat rather than the brand of the restaurant. High standards in service vessels elevate simple meals.

DIY Drink Stations And Dessert Tables That Delight Every Guest

Liquor costs remain the largest expense in event beverage service. Buy beer and wine in bulk from warehouse clubs like Costco. Limit the selection to two types of beer and two wine varieties. Skip the full bar to avoid expensive mixers and garnish inventory. Use large galvanized steel tubs filled with ice to hold drinks. This setup allows guests to serve themselves without a hired bartender.

Ditch the multi tier wedding cake. Custom cakes for thirty people often cost four hundred dollars. Buy a variety of small desserts from a local bakery instead. Serve tarts, brownies, and cookies on tiered glass stands. This creates a visually dense display for a fraction of the cost. Buy one small cutting cake for the tradition. A dessert table offers more variety and costs less than fifty dollars.

Budget Friendly Photography And Music Tips For Couples With Weddings Under 5000 Budget

Photography and music drive the atmosphere of your event. Most professional wedding photographers charge more than your entire two thousand dollar budget. You must find alternatives to capture the day. Hire a talented university photography student rather than a studio owner. They have modern gear and need to build a portfolio. You get high quality digital files for a fraction of the market price.

  • Hire Photography Students: Contact local college art departments to find students with professional grade cameras. These individuals understand lighting and composition but lack the high overhead costs of established wedding businesses. You pay for their time and skill without the luxury branding premium.
  • Limit Shooting Hours: Book your photographer for three hours instead of ten. Focus their time on the ceremony and formal portraits only. This covers the most important visual memories. You do not need professional coverage of the entire reception to have a high quality wedding album.
  • Curated Digital Playlists: Use a premium streaming service to build a custom music set. Direct the energy of the room with specific songs for the entrance and dinner. Modern Bluetooth speakers provide enough volume for thirty guests. You eliminate the cost of a DJ while maintaining total control.
  • User Generated Content: Create a shared digital folder for your guests. Use a QR code on the tables so friends can upload their candid phone photos instantly. This provides hundreds of different angles of your wedding. You get immediate access to memories while waiting for the official edited photos.
  • Inexpensive Lighting: Buy string lights or LED up-lights to set the mood. Good lighting makes cheap venues look expensive. Warm white bulbs create a high end feel for a low cost. This tactical move improves the quality of every photo taken by your guests and your photographer.

Music does not require a live band or a professional DJ to be effective. A group of thirty people needs background audio rather than a concert setup. Use your own device and a high quality speaker. This strategy saves you five hundred to one thousand dollars. Dedicate those savings to food or venue costs. Tactical planning ensures the vibe stays consistent throughout the evening.

Negotiation And Timing Tricks That Unlock Vendor Discounts Most Couples Miss

Booking during the off-season or middle of the week slashes prices immediately. Venues and photographers often face empty calendars on Tuesdays or Wednesdays. They will accept lower rates to fill these gaps. Always ask for a custom package based on a short time frame. A three-hour booking costs significantly less than a full day. High-volume periods like Saturdays in June command the highest prices and offer zero leverage for negotiation.

Target vendors who are building their portfolios for the best rates. New professionals offer high-quality work at a fraction of the market price to gain experience. Look for talent on social media platforms or local colleges. Be direct about your budget constraints from the first message. Many vendors have unlisted small-scale packages for groups of 30. Eliminating unnecessary services like physical albums or extra assistants keeps the total cost low.
